    As impressive az it is, the problem with this kind of skill test is that they are often beyond the accuracy capability of a rifle and just become a test of luck.

    Unless the rifle is capable of stacking shots right on top of each at that range, or shooting clover leafs then it comes down to luck, as no amount of wind reading skills or being a good shot is going to make up for the rifles accuracy.
